When you use a computer, you expect everything to work perfectly every time. Unfortunately, software glitches, driver conflicts, and unexpected updates can disrupt that stability. A restore point acts as a safety net, capturing a specific snapshot of your system settings and installed programs. This mechanism allows you to revert your device to a previous, functional state without losing personal files, provided it was created before the issue began.
How System Restore Works Under the Hood
At its core, this technology monitors changes to critical system areas. It does not back up every file on your drive, which keeps it efficient. Instead, it tracks modifications to registry settings, system files, and installed applications. Before any significant change, such as installing new hardware or software, the service creates a restore point. If something goes wrong later, you can roll back these specific changes, effectively undoing the update or installation while keeping your personal data intact.
Manual Creation vs. Automatic Snapshots
There are generally two ways these safety nets are generated. The first is automatic; modern operating systems create restore points weekly and just before any detected system change. You can also create them manually before attempting risky modifications. This manual step is highly recommended before installing untested software or major Windows updates. Having a user-defined snapshot gives you peace of mind, knowing you have a guaranteed recovery option tailored to your specific needs.
Scheduling and Protection Levels
You have control over how much disk space this feature uses. In the configuration settings, you can adjust the maximum space allowed for storing these snapshots. It is important to allocate enough room, as older points are automatically deleted to make space for new ones. Furthermore, you can protect specific drives, usually the main system drive, while excluding others like large media storage drives where frequent changes occur but are not necessary to protect.
Recovery Process and Limitations
Using a restore point does not delete your personal documents, photos, or downloads. The process targets system files and settings only, leaving user data untouched. However, be aware of its boundaries. if you install a new program and then create a snapshot, you cannot revert to that point to remove the program. Additionally, any drivers or applications installed after the snapshot will be removed during the rollback. This makes it crucial to create the snapshot as close to the problem’s origin as possible.
When System Files Become Corrupted
One of the most valuable use cases is repairing a corrupted system. If Windows fails to boot correctly or critical system files are damaged, you can often access Advanced Startup Options. From here, selecting "System Restore" and choosing an earlier point can resurrect a stable environment. This process is often faster and more reliable than attempting manual repairs or a full OS reinstall, saving hours of troubleshooting and potential data recovery stress.
Best Practices for Maintaining Safety
To ensure this feature is effective when you need it, a few best practices are essential. First, verify that the protection is turned on for your primary drive through the system properties menu. Second, create a manual snapshot before major life events on your computer, such as installing new hardware or updating graphics drivers. Finally, understand that while this is a vital tool, it is not a substitute for a full backup strategy. Use dedicated backup software to archive your personal files to an external drive or cloud storage for complete protection.
